What Is a Muzzle Brake and How Does It Benefit 6.5 Creedmoor Users?
A muzzle brake is a device attached to the muzzle of a firearm that redirects propellant gases to counter recoil and muzzle rise when the weapon is fired. This results in improved control and accuracy, particularly for high-recoil rifles such as the 6.5 Creedmoor.
According to the National Shooting Sports Foundation (NSSF), muzzle brakes can reduce recoil by up to 50%, making them an essential accessory for competitive shooters and hunters alike who aim to enhance their shooting experience and performance.
Key aspects of a muzzle brake include its design and the method by which it redirects gases. Most muzzle brakes feature ports on the top and sides that divert gases outward and rearward. This counteracts the natural tendency of the rifle to lift during firing, allowing the shooter to maintain sight alignment for quicker follow-up shots. For 6.5 Creedmoor users, whose cartridges produce significant recoil, a well-designed muzzle brake can make a substantial difference in handling and comfort.

How Do You Properly Install a Muzzle Brake on a 6.5 Creedmoor Rifle?
To properly install a muzzle brake on a 6.5 Creedmoor rifle, you need to follow specific steps and utilize the right tools and components.
- Select the Best Muzzle Brake: Choose a muzzle brake that is designed specifically for 6.5 Creedmoor, focusing on recoil reduction and muzzle rise management.
- Gather Necessary Tools: Ensure you have all the required tools such as a torque wrench, crush washer, and appropriate wrenches for installation.
- Safety First: Always ensure the rifle is unloaded and the chamber is clear before starting the installation process.
- Remove the Existing Muzzle Device: Carefully unscrew the existing muzzle device, if present, using the appropriate wrench while ensuring not to damage the barrel.
- Prepare the Muzzle: Clean the muzzle threads thoroughly to remove any debris or old thread locker, ensuring a clean surface for the new muzzle brake.
- Install the Crush Washer: Place a crush washer onto the muzzle, ensuring it is oriented correctly for the muzzle brake installation.
- Attach the Muzzle Brake: Screw the muzzle brake onto the threads, hand-tightening it initially before using a torque wrench to secure it to the manufacturer’s specifications.
- Check Alignment: Ensure the muzzle brake is properly aligned, which may require slight adjustments to achieve optimal positioning for gas dispersion.
- Final Tightening: Use the torque wrench to tighten the muzzle brake to the specified torque, ensuring it is secure but not over-tightened to avoid damage.
- Test the Installation: After installation, conduct a function test at the range to ensure the muzzle brake performs effectively and the rifle functions correctly.
What Maintenance Practices Ensure Optimal Performance of Your Muzzle Brake?
To ensure optimal performance of your muzzle brake, consider the following maintenance practices:
- Regular Cleaning: Regularly clean the muzzle brake to remove carbon buildup and debris.
- Inspection for Damage: Frequently inspect the muzzle brake for signs of wear or damage to ensure it functions correctly.
- Proper Installation: Ensure the muzzle brake is correctly installed to prevent issues such as misalignment or excessive recoil.
- Use of Proper Ammunition: Utilize ammunition that is compatible with your muzzle brake to maintain performance and prevent unnecessary wear.
- Periodic Torque Checks: Check the torque settings on the mounting system at regular intervals to prevent loosening during use.
Regular Cleaning: Muzzle brakes can accumulate carbon and lead deposits, which can affect their efficiency and performance. Cleaning the brake after each shooting session helps maintain proper gas flow and reduces the risk of corrosion.
Inspection for Damage: Regular inspections help identify any cracks, chips, or deformations that could impair the muzzle brake’s functionality. Early detection of damage allows for timely repairs or replacements, ensuring the brake operates efficiently.
Proper Installation: A muzzle brake must be installed according to the manufacturer’s specifications to function optimally. Misalignment can lead to increased recoil and muzzle rise, diminishing the brake’s effectiveness.
Use of Proper Ammunition: Ensuring that the ammunition used is suitable for the muzzle brake helps maintain its longevity and performance. Incompatible ammunition can produce excessive pressure or gas flow that may damage the brake over time.
Periodic Torque Checks: The mounting system can loosen over time due to shooting vibrations, which may affect the brake’s performance. Regular torque checks can prevent the brake from becoming loose, ensuring consistent operation and recoil management.
